Albert H. Maldonado is a former judge for the Superior Court of Monterey County in California.[1] He filed for re-election in 2014, but due to facing no opposition, was automatically re-elected.[2] Maldonado retired from the bench on June 30, 2017.[3]
Elections
2014
See also: California judicial elections, 2014
Maldonado ran for re-election to the Monterey County Superior Court.
As an unopposed incumbent, he was automatically re-elected without appearing on the ballot.

Education
Maldonado received a bachelor's degree from the University of Redlands and a J.D. from the University of California, Berkeley Boalt Hall School of Law.[4]
